A tip while trimming the foam if it starts to cling to you
grab a fabric softening sheet if you use them and rub it over the foam
a few times and wipe your hands with it as well.
It will cut down on the static. I did not use pick&pluck so I don't know
if it will do that or not. I used some foam blocks I had here and hacked it up.
So I had slivers of foam clinging all over the place
